Boulder Valley School District receives grant to expand anti-bullying efforts

Thursday, December 09, 2021
9 NEWS

BOULDER, Colorado — Boulder Valley School District is focusing on new anti-bullying programs, and a new grant will help expand them further. 

The Boulder Valley School District piloted an anti-bullying curriculum at Columbine Elementary School, Sanchez Elementary School and Pioneer Bilingual Elementary School.
